SQL Serverデータベースのバックアップとリストア
バックアップ文:
リストア文:
Backup Database db_JiuShanJiu To Disk='E://DataBak//bak1.bak'
-- : C , 。
リストア文:
USE master
DECLARE tb CURSOR LOCAL FOR SELECT 'Kill '+ CAST(Spid AS VARCHAR) FROM master.dbo.sysprocesses
WHERE dbid=DB_ID('db_JiuShanJiu')
DECLARE @s nvarchar(1000) OPEN tb FETCH tb INTO @s
WHILE @@FETCH_STATUS = 0 BEGIN EXEC (@s) FETCH tb INTO @s END CLOSE tb DEALLOCATE tb
RESTORE DATABASE db_JiuShanJiu FROM Disk='E://DataBak//bak1.bak'